The House Edge Explained
The «house edge» is the built-in mathematical advantage that a casino has over its players. This is not a matter of luck; it’s a carefully calculated percentage that ensures the casino remains profitable over time. For example, in many slot machines, the house edge might be around 5%, meaning that for every $100 wagered, the machine is programmed to return $95 to players on average, keeping $5 for the casino. Different games have different house edges, with some being more favorable to players than others.
Games like blackjack, when played with optimal strategy, can offer a lower house edge compared to games of pure chance like roulette or slot machines. This is because blackjack involves player decisions and skill. However, even with perfect strategy, a small house edge often remains. Understanding the house edge for each game allows players to choose those that offer better odds, or at least to be aware of the statistical disadvantage they face with every wager.

The Role of Randomness and Variance
While mathematics dictates the long-term probabilities, short-term results in gambling are heavily influenced by randomness and variance. Variance refers to the degree to which actual outcomes deviate from the expected value. A player might experience a winning streak due to luck, even though the underlying probabilities are against them. Conversely, a player could hit a losing streak despite playing optimally.
Understanding variance is key to managing expectations. It explains why some players win significantly in the short term, while others consistently lose. It’s important to remember that variance is temporary. Over a vast number of plays, the mathematical edge of the casino will eventually assert itself. Recognizing this distinction between short-term luck and long-term mathematical certainty allows players to enjoy the game without succumbing to false hopes or excessive disappointment.
